Testing is an important part of health care
In addition to pursuing a diagnosis when the pet shows signs of not feeling well, it's a peace-of-mind, health assurance maker when regular testing is incorprorated with the regularly scheduled wellness examinations. This especially so in the case of older patients, starting at age 7 yrs and older. Testing also helps in monitoring the patient's progress in recovery from an illness.

Home Care for Animals also encourages home urine testing. Specimens can also be shipped in quality preserving ccoolant containers to the Phillips Urine Cytology and Testing Center for optimal results.
Home Care for Animals considers a urinalysis to be an effective test in monitoring health. Most of the chemistry results can be done at your home and the results can be reported to us to incorporate in your pet's health ongoing health story. This is a low cost procedure.
